Job Summary
As 3rd shift Production Supervisor, you will lead hourly employees in the Cheese and Drying departments, ensuring high‑quality production within scheduled timelines while maintaining safety and efficiency.
Key Responsibilities- Lead and coach hourly employees, providing performance reviews and mentorship.
- Make corrections and coordinate with Production Leads and Trainers.
- Promote diversity and inclusion within the team.
- Focus on continuous improvement in cost, quality, service, people, and environment through efficient use of materials, equipment, and resources.
- Share best practices within the facility, across the supply chain, and with external resources to achieve advanced manufacturing and supply chain technologies.
- Partner with plant management, quality, maintenance, human resources, scheduling, and logistics to align goals.
- Ensure safety, quality, delivery, and morale at the Kiel facility.
- Investigate root‑cause and corrective action for unplanned events.
- Maintain compliance with GMPs and the Food Safety Plan.
- Coordinate with supervisors and functions to optimize operations and resources.
- Plan and establish work schedules, assignments, and production schedules to meet and exceed customer requirements and business goals.
- Analyze the financial impact of line efficiency, material yield, and labor productivity on plant budgets and develop action plans to address gaps.
- High school diploma or GED with at least 2 years of shift‑supervision experience (preferably in food processing).
- Experience with GMPs, HACCP, sanitation, and quality assurance.
- Strong leadership, problem‑solving, and decision‑making skills.
- Excellent oral, written, and presentation communication skills at all company levels.
- Positive influence and ability to lead through example.
- Computer skills, including Microsoft Office (Word, Excel, Outlook, PowerPoint).
- Effective cross‑functional communication in a fast‑paced environment.
- Lean manufacturing knowledge and continuous improvement experience.
- Ability to manage multiple projects while remaining organized and detail‑oriented.
- Preferred: A four‑year degree in Business Administration, Science/Food Science, Engineering, Agriculture, or related field.
- Preferred: 1+ year of operations experience, supervisory experience in a unionized environment, and openness to relocation.
- Preferred:
Lean Management and continuous improvement experience.
Requires occasional walking, standing, handling small objects, reaching, stooping, climbing stairs and ladders, lifting up to 50 pounds, and use of hearing and vision. Work conditions may include temperature fluctuations, occasional high noise levels requiring protective equipment, and exposure to weather conditions.
Work Schedule and Compensation3rd shift: 10:45pm–7:00am. Overtime, weekend, and holiday hours may be required. Pay range: $70,800.00–$88,500.00–$ USD per year.
